Frequently Asked Questions

Does Beijing University of Law offer CSC scholarships for international students?

Beijing University of Law participates in Chinese Government Scholarship (CSC) schemes alongside university and provincial awards. Eligibility, coverage, and documents vary by program — confirm the current list on the official international admissions website.

Are there English-taught programs at Beijing University of Law?

Many programs at leading Chinese universities include English-taught tracks at master's and PhD level; some bachelor's options exist in select faculties. Always verify the language of instruction on the official program page before applying.

What documents are usually required to apply?

Typical applications include passport copy, academic transcripts, study plan, recommendation letters (for graduate programs), language proof (HSK and/or IELTS/TOEFL where required), medical form, and a non-criminal record certificate. Requirements differ by faculty — use the official checklist.
